The Need to Balance Mental Health and Work for Women Leaders
As part of a half hour special dedicated to women business leaders, Steve Adubato sits down with Michele N. Siekerka, Esq., President & CEO, New Jersey Business and Industry Association, to discuss the 2021 Annual Women Business Leaders Forum, the reasons why women were disproportionately impacted by the pandemic, and the importance of managing mental health and work life balance.
